Job description

Job Summary

National Interstate is a member of Great American Insurance Group. As one of the leading commercial transportation insurers in the nation, we offer risk financing solutions in all 50 states tailored to meet the needs of a wide variety of transportation classes. Our offerings include traditional insurance and innovative alternative risk transfer (ART) programs, including more than a dozen group captive programs catering to niche wheels markets. We are proud to be a multiple Northcoast 99 winner and Cleveland Plain Dealer Top Workplace in Northeast Ohio. It is because of our talented and dedicated team that we are able to live out our company values of integrity, transparency, fairness, accountability, empowerment and collaboration with each transaction we make. At Great American, we value and recognize the benefits derived when people with different backgrounds and experiences work together to achieve business results. Our goal is to create a workplace where all employees feel included, empowered, and enabled to perform at their best. Since 1989, National Interstate has specialized in serving the insurance needs of the wheels-based transportation industry. Our steadfast focus on developing niche expertise in product design, loss control and claim services has made National Interstate one of the most respected names in commercial transportation insurance today. https://natl.com/ National Interstate is looking for a Senior Claims Representative Auto Property Damage to join their team. This individual will work a hybrid or fully remote schedule out of the Richfield, OH office. National Interstate’s culture is built on connection, shared learning, and strong relationships. To support this, employees in this role are expected to be on-site four days a week, with the flexibility to work one day remotely. Core in‑office days are Tuesday–Thursday, with the fourth day determined by business needs.

Essential Job Functions and Responsibilities
  • Manages an inventory of claims to evaluate compensability/liability.
  • Plans and conducts claim investigations to confirm coverage and to determine liability, compensability and damages.
  • Determines and negotiates appropriate claim settlements/reserves within prescribed authority.
  • May attend arbitrations, mediations, depositions, or trials.
  • Conveys moderately complex information regarding coverage and settlements to insureds, claimants, and external partners.
  • Authorizes payments in accordance with assigned authority limit and ensures payments are made in a timely manner.
  • Maintains accurate and detailed claim files, including all correspondence, reports, and settlement agreements.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
Job Requirements
  • Education: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ration, Risk Management and Insurance, Finance, or a related field or equivalent experience.
  • Experience: Generally, a minimum of 5 years of experience in property and casualty claims handling. Completion of or continuing progress toward a professional designation preferred, such as Associate in Claims (AIC).
Scope of Job/Qualifications
  • Works within significant limits and authority on assignments of higher technical complexity and coordination.
  • Demonstrates strong analytical, negotiation, and problem‑solving skills.
  • Demonstrates knowledge of insurance policies, coverage, and claims handling procedures.
  • Maintains knowledge of industry laws and regulations.
  • Demonstrates ability to organize and prioritize caseloads, ensuring timely resolution of claims.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to build relationships and lead negotiations.
  • Proven 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
